Output 02316ea3612f32cab79b7bf575ce5b9b7d35246bf8be81154ab8c0d697ea0813:3

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d071ca8371f691de6ec5e794339f48802a5925 OP_EQUAL
address
3EFiCoUHjcXgdowhx1VM1B229UDro8xU9h
transaction
02316ea3612f32cab79b7bf575ce5b9b7d35246bf8be81154ab8c0d697ea0813
spent
true